STV currently has an opening for an Aviation Planner in the Construction Management group in

Chicago, IL.Aviation Planner responsibilitiesPlanning work may include, but is not limited to, inventory of existing conditions, forecasting, capacity analysis, facility requirements, alternatives development, and CIP planning for master plan projects and other planning studies.Airfield/airspace planning will be a focus of the position, but responsibilities will also include elements of landside, terminal area, cargo, and support facilities planning. System planning elements are also included in the list of possible assignments.ResponsibilitiesPerforming planning activities as part of a larger planning team.Working collaboratively with engineering teams to support design projects.Participating in and directing the production of high-quality exhibits and documents to communicate the results of the planning study elements.Leading/managing planning projects and working closely with our clients.Contributing significantly to the overall success of the team and the team's projects.Pursuing certifications (AICP, AAAE CM, PMP), as appropriate.Requirements:Bachelor's degree in aviation management, aeronautical science, planning, engineering, or a related field.Min of 10 years + of experience in aviation planning.Technical expertise in standard airport planning procedures and approaches.Knowledge of FARs, FAA Advisory Circulars, and FAA orders that apply to airport planning.Proficient in tabulation, data management, software, and publication programs used for airport planning.2 years of experience in a consulting firm environment.2 years of experience working with FAA ADIP.Compensation Range: $69,872.00 - $93,163.00Don't meet every single requirement?
